|
- diff -Naur Python-3.8.0-orig/Lib/ssl.py Python-3.8.0/Lib/ssl.py
- --- Python-3.8.0-orig/Lib/ssl.py 2019-10-14 16:34:47.000000000 +0300
- +++ Python-3.8.0/Lib/ssl.py 2019-10-22 10:04:00.493059100 +0300
- @@ -249,7 +249,7 @@
- CHANGE_CIPHER_SPEC = 0x0101
-
-
- -if sys.platform == "win32":
- +if sys.platform == "win32" and sys.version.find("GCC") == -1:
- from _ssl import enum_certificates, enum_crls
-
- from socket import socket, AF_INET, SOCK_STREAM, create_connection
- @@ -569,7 +569,7 @@
- def load_default_certs(self, purpose=Purpose.SERVER_AUTH):
- if not isinstance(purpose, _ASN1Object):
- raise TypeError(purpose)
- - if sys.platform == "win32":
- + if sys.platform == "win32" and sys.version.find("GCC") == -1:
- for storename in self._windows_cert_stores:
- self._load_windows_store_certs(storename, purpose)
- self.set_default_verify_paths()
|